Sewer cleanout services involve inspecting, clearing, and maintaining the main sewer lines that connect a property’s plumbing system to the municipal sewer system. These services typically include the removal of blockages caused by debris, grease buildup, or tree roots, as well as the installation or replacement of cleanout access points. Professionals use specialized equipment such as augers, high-pressure water jetters, and video cameras to identify issues within the sewer lines and ensure they are functioning properly. Regular cleanouts can help prevent more serious plumbing problems by maintaining smooth and unobstructed flow within the sewer system.
This service addresses common problems like slow drains, foul odors, backups, and frequent clogs that can disrupt daily routines. Blockages within the main sewer line can lead to wastewater backing up into sinks, toilets, or even the yard, causing property damage and health concerns. Sewer cleanout services help identify the root causes of these issues, allowing for targeted solutions that restore proper drainage and prevent future complications. In addition, they can assist with repairs or replacements of damaged or aging sewer lines, extending the lifespan of the plumbing infrastructure.
Both residential and commercial properties typically utilize sewer cleanout services to maintain their plumbing systems. Homes with mature trees nearby often experience root intrusion, which can lead to severe blockages if not addressed promptly. Apartment complexes, office buildings, restaurants, and retail establishments also rely on these services to ensure their sewer lines remain clear and functional. Proper maintenance of sewer cleanouts is especially important in properties with high water usage or older infrastructure, where the risk of clogs and backups is increased.

Service Costs - Sewer cleanout services typically range from $150 to $350 for standard installations or cleanouts. Larger or more complex projects can cost up to $500 or more, depending on the scope of work.
Labor Expenses - The cost for labor usually falls between $75 and $150 per hour, with total costs influenced by the project's complexity and location. Some jobs may require additional work, increasing overall expenses.
Material Fees - Materials such as cleanout fittings or piping generally add $50 to $200 to the total cost, depending on the type and quality of materials used. These costs are often included in the overall service estimate.
Additional Charges - Extra fees may apply for emergency services, extensive pipe repairs, or troubleshooting, which can increase the total cost by $100 or more. It’s advisable to obtain detailed estimates from local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
